Invitae RCV003534617 SCV000821429 uncertain significance Familial adenomatous polyposis 1 2023-05-07 criteria provided, single submitter clinical testing In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. Advanced modeling of protein sequence and biophysical properties (such as structural, functional, and spatial information, amino acid conservation, physicochemical variation, residue mobility, and thermodynamic stability) performed at Invitae indicates that this missense variant is not expected to disrupt APC protein function. ClinVar contains an entry for this variant (Variation ID: 572224). This variant has not been reported in the literature in individuals affected with APC-related conditions. This variant is present in population databases (no rsID available, gnomAD 0.009%). This sequence change replaces cysteine, which is neutral and slightly polar, with serine, which is neutral and polar, at codon 1249 of the APC protein (p.Cys1249Ser).
Ambry Genetics RCV002343474 SCV002621956 likely benign Hereditary cancer-predisposing syndrome 2022-04-25 criteria provided, single submitter clinical testing This alteration is classified as likely benign based on a combination of the following: population frequency, intact protein function, lack of segregation with disease, co-occurrence, RNA analysis, in silico models, amino acid conservation, lack of disease association in case-control studies, and/or the mechanism of disease or impacted region is inconsistent with a known cause of pathogenicity.
